Pizza is probably one of the most popular foods in America - and
one of the most versatile.
It can be eaten for breakfast, lunch, dinner or a snack. The cook
can throw just about anything his or her heart desires on it.
So, for October, National Pizza Month, I offer the following
pizza for those who like to make their own - from McCormick, the
spice makers.
